US,Argentine doctors to do surgery with robot arms
www.chinaview.cn 2005-11-19 10:34:11

    BUENOS AIRES, Nov. 18 (Xinhuanet) -- A team of doctors from the United States and Argentina will do surgery with robot arms, the first one in Latin America, an expert from the team told Argentineradio on Friday.

    The robot arms will operate on the esophagus of a patient with a digestive disorder in the Clincas Hospital in Buenos Aires on Sunday, Luis Zarato said.

    Surgeons will use robot arms instead of operating by hand to domuch more delicate and precise work.

    The robot arms are part of a joint project between the University of Buenos Aires, which owns the Clinicas Hospital, and the University of Illinois of the United States. Enditem
